Australia hopes the United States swimmer Michael Phelps, are interested in a duel with Ian Thorpe before the 2012 London Olympics.
Thorpe, regarded as Australia's greatest swimmer, decided to return to the world of swimming and is now practicing in Switzerland. Thorpe was determined to achieve peak performance in the London Olympics.
Phelps has refused an invitation to participate in the race series in Sydney last January. However, the authorities hope Phelps Swimming Australia will come next year to deal with Thorpe.
"Last year we had sent a invitation to Phelps, but failed. meeting of the two is still too early, but interesting to talk about," said Swimming Australia chief executive, Kevin Neil.
Thorpe never doubted the ability of Phelps to break the record of legendary U.S. swimmer Mark Spitz, with seven Olympic gold, ahead of the Beijing 2008 Olympic Games. In fact, Phelps actually encouraged by this speech and be able to win eight gold medals.
